Phesheya Dlamini is a scholar working on Soil Science, Plant Science and Ecology. According to data from OpenAlex, Phesheya Dlamini has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 754 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Soil Science, 8 papers in Plant Science and 7 papers in Ecology. Recurrent topics in Phesheya Dlamini's work include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(9 papers), Soil erosion and sediment transport (6 papers) and Rangeland Management and Livestock Ecology (5 papers). Phesheya Dlamini is often cited by papers focused on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(9 papers), Soil erosion and sediment transport (6 papers) and Rangeland Management and Livestock Ecology (5 papers). Phesheya Dlamini collaborates with scholars based in South Africa, France and Laos. Phesheya Dlamini's co-authors include Vincent Chaplot, Pauline Chivenge, A. D. Manson, L. van Rensburg, Graham Jewitt, Simon Lorentz, Louis Titshall, Robert Schall, C. C. du Preez and Thobela Louis Tyasi and has published in prestigious journals such as Agriculture Ecosystems & Environment, Geoderma and Sustainability.
